Brave Diamonds through on penalties

Hinckley Borough Diamonds proudly sponsored by Impact Retail, MJB Motors and CPS group welcomed Sileby Panthers to Weavers Park in the 2nd round of the county cup.

Sileby kicked off and straight away showed they were full of intent, beating the Diamonds to every ball and testing the resilience of Alara, Emily, and Bethan at the back. The Sileby midfield who were physically strong were winning the battle and causing problems for Lacey, Ellie O and Violet. The diamonds were really struggling to get anything going and the Sileby pressure was causing the Diamonds girls to panic and rush.

To the Diamonds' credit, they rode the storm and in the 10th minute Amelia managed to spin her marker and release Violet down the left wing, Violet got to the byline and cut the ball back, and with the goal gaping a wicked bobble took the ball off Ellie O's foot for the first clear cut chance of the game.

5 minutes later with the Diamonds still not getting to grips with the opposition they were deservedly behind when the hunger of the Sileby players again found them first to the ball and when the striker found herself inside the box unmarked, she stroked the ball past stand-in keeper Lexi U.

The diamonds brought on Jayla, Poppi, Lilly B, and skipper Millie to try and get a foothold in the game, and have something to build on. Sileby though were relentless in their pressure and the Diamonds went into the halftime break extremely fortunate to still be in the cup tie.
HT0-1

At halftime Lilly B bravely took the gloves of Lexi U who despite being ill had a good half in the goal. The girls were told at half-time that the very least expected of them all was to run and compete with their opposition and match the hunger of the other team. The result didn't matter but the lack of effort and poor performance did matter.

The second half kicked off and the brutally honest teamtalk seemed to have had an impact with the diamonds starting to apply some pressure of their own, Lacey was winning more of the ball and Violet and Millie were forcing the wide midfielders back while Amelia and Lily S were stretching the defence with their skill, pace and power. Now we had a cup tie.

Ellie O, Lily S and Amelia all had good half chances but the Sileby Keeper was in inspired form, while a series of corners had Sileby pinned in the Diamonds just couldn't find the finish to ring them level.

Sileby were not taking the pressure lying down and were more than willing to commit players forward when they could, these counter-attacks were bringing the best out of Bethan, Alara and Emily and Lily B in goal who pulled off a couple of good saves. The diamonds were somehow still in the game and then from a goal kick Ellie O put the defender under pressure this resulted in Lily S picking up the ball beating a defender and when her shot was spilled Amelia tapped in the rebound to make it 1-1 with minutes left of the tie and take the game to penalties.

And so to penalties ....
Sileby took the first kick and scored with the ball bouncing in off the bar 0-1

Amelia then stepped forward and despite the keeper getting a hand to the ball her shot was too powerful and went in 1-1

Lilly B then became a hero with a huge save saving with her legs down to the right to give the diamonds the advantage. 1-1

Violet confidently stroked her left foot penalty into the corner to give the Diamonds an advantage. 2-1

The third sileby penalty although well-struck missed the target. 2-1

Next up was Bethan she put the ball on the spot took 5 steps back and smashed an unstoppable penalty into the top corner 3-1

Sileby then scored their fouth penalty 3-2

Vice-captain Alara then took the long walk from the halfway line put the ball on the spot stepped back, took a deep breath, and side footed the ball into the right-hand corner suddenly the girls were off racing to Alara and Lilly B to congratulate them 4-2

The diamonds were nowhere near their best today but they did just enough to stay in the game and got their rewards for a much improved 2nd half. A performance of grit and effort saw them through today GOTG Lilly B
